Quick note on how Fernwood's shared component library handles versions: every release of the Thimbleset package gets tagged by the publish bot, and the registry rejects anything unsigned. If you're auditing this, the piece to care about is that the bot authenticates to the internal Quillgate registry on each publish. For reproducing a publish locally during review, you'll need the bot's registry key, shown here.

app token of kaduf-hagug = vxb4-Q0rH

Q3 Planning Note — Headcount

Hey sales leads — quick heads-up on next year's hiring plan. We're budgeting for six new reps across the Velmora and Kestrel Bay territories, plus one enablement hire. Marit will share role profiles after the offsite. Nothing's locked until finance signs off, so keep this loose for now. Before you socialize anything, read the note below.

confidential, kagep-kahof: Druokax Systems plans to lower the Ulaath list price by 53 percent in March.

// Dependency pinning policy for Quillbox plugins
//
// Short version: pin everything. The constant below sets the maximum
// allowed version skew between your plugin's lockfile and the Quillbox
// core lockfile. We learned the hard way (see the Great Marlow Outage
// writeup) that floating minor versions breaks plugin ABI in ways the
// loader can't detect until runtime. If you genuinely need a newer dep,
// request an exemption in the plugin portal rather than loosening this.
// Exemption requests must quote the core build token shown below.

build token for bahif-kawig: htk21_9cc972c67d58f746a5122

The Remindwell job dispatches appointment reminders for Cliniqa clinics every evening at 18:00 local time. Before contacting the scheduling service, it authenticates against the internal Pagegate relay, which enforces a per-clinic rate limit of 200 messages per minute. If the relay rejects the handshake, check that the credential has not expired. The job authenticates using the key shown immediately below.

API key for yahig-tadup: kto7_ubizbYm